Rounding to the nearest hundred represents a fundamental Year 4 mathematical skill that builds students' number sense and prepares them for more advanced mathematical concepts. Wayground's comprehensive collection of rounding to the nearest hundred worksheets provides Year 4 students with systematic practice opportunities that strengthen their understanding of place value, number relationships, and estimation strategies. These carefully designed printables guide students through the step-by-step process of identifying the hundreds place, examining the tens digit, and applying rounding rules consistently. Each worksheet includes varied practice problems that progress from basic three-digit numbers to more complex four-digit scenarios, ensuring students develop confidence with this essential skill.
